Способы установки и настройки WayDroid в Ubuntu 22.04: подробное руководство

Под «WayDroid Ubuntu 22.04» подразумевается использование WayDroid в Ubuntu 22.04. WayDroid — это технология, позволяющая запускать приложения Android в дистрибутивах Linux с использованием контейнерного подхода. Ниже приведены несколько методов, которые можно использовать для установки и настройки WayDroid в Ubuntu 22.04, а также примеры кода:

Метод 1: установка WayDroid через репозиторий APT

# Add the WayDroid APT repository
sudo add-apt-repository ppa:waydroid/stable
# Update the package list
sudo apt update
# Install WayDroid
sudo apt install waydroid

Метод 2: сборка WayDroid из исходного кода

# Install build dependencies
sudo apt install build-essential cmake pkg-config lib32ncurses5-dev libprotobuf-dev protobuf-compiler protobuf-c-compiler libx11-dev libxext-dev libxrender-dev libxcursor-dev libxi-dev libnss3-dev libxcomposite-dev libxtst-dev libssl-dev libxcb1-dev libgconf2-dev libgconf-2-4 libdbus-1-dev libxkbcommon-dev libxss-dev libxslt1-dev libxslt1.1 libxslt1-dev libxml2-utils
# Clone the WayDroid repository
git clone https://github.com/WayDroid/waydroid.git
# Build WayDroid
cd waydroid
mkdir build && cd build
cmake ..
make
sudo make install

Метод 3: использование Snap Package

# Install WayDroid via Snap
sudo snap install waydroid

Метод 4. Использование Flatpak

# Install Flatpak
sudo apt install flatpak
# Add Flathub repository
fl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o
# Install WayDroid
flatpak install flathub com.waydroid.waydroid

Метод 5. Использование Docker

# Install Docker
sudo apt install docker.io
# Download and run the WayDroid Docker image
sudo docker run -it --privileged -e WAYDROID_DISPLAY=wayland waydroid/waydroid

Вот некоторые способы установки и настройки WayDroid в Ubuntu 22.04. У каждого метода есть свои преимущества и требования, поэтому выберите тот, который лучше всего соответствует вашим потребностям.